A fan oven will generally cycle the air out and bring in new air which will accept more moisture, but a conventional oven won''t, so you either have to crack the door or open it every 10 minutes to bring fresh air in. All in all it takes days to dry chillies in a fan oven with it being constantly on, and it will stink up your house while doing it.

Oven Drying Preheat an oven to 125 degrees Fahrenheit. Rinse off the peppers, removing any garden dirt. Cut the peppers in half using a sharp knife. Lay the peppers on a baking sheet, spreading them out so that the halves do not touch one another. Bake the jalapenos slowly for 2 to 3 hours, turning the halves every half hour.
